Plot

The Island of Sodor has many plans for the coming year. Sodor was expanding its industry and railway enterprise. As the new year begins, Sir Topham Hatt calls a meeting of the engines. After James complains, chaos occurs. 'Arry and Bert cause even more trouble by calling steam engines "steam kettles" which starts a huge argument. Sir Topham Hatt stops the bickering and announces his plans for the railway throughout the year.

The first project is the new Lift Bridge at Tidmouth. A few months later, the bridge is complete. Oliver and Toad are sent there to pick up a goods train to take to the Small Railway. Toad thinks it'll be a trip to remember, but Oliver disagrees. When Oliver and Toad arrive, they are not surprised to see Mike and Frank are arguing as usual.

Later, Murdoch was chatting with Duck. Duck explains to Murdoch that the bridge has a signal that goes down when the bridge is upright. Just then, a fuse box short-circuited, causing Oliver's signal to malfunction, unknown to him that the bridge is in the upright position. Oliver and his train crashed, as Henry comes by and collides as well. Sir Topham Hatt saw the whole accident and is very cross. He thinks that it may be a bad omen to the year ahead.
